Thunder

Thunder
Black Col-erase pencil on Canson watercolor paper, 11.5″ x 7.5″. Reference photo by Alicia.

This is Thunder, my 11 year old King Shepherd cross Golden Retriever. We got him November 2nd (my mom’s birthday) after she saw him in a pet store (we now know pet stores are terrible) He was only 8 weeks old and already huge and a big ball of fluff. The reason we got him was because my other dog had a false pregnancy (before we knew about all the dogs in shelters) the vet said to buy her a puppy so she wouldn’t be depressed and would think she at least had one puppy. Thunder grew up to be the most gentle and pleasing dog ever. He learns new tricks within 2 hours, he’s always trying to be with someone and loves any attention. Thunder loves all our bunnies and lets them cuddle into him and jump all over him. He helped raise a little baby I had and when the baby grew up she followed Thunder everywhere and he always watched over her. – Alicia
